Product Description

The GBC Catena 105 Roll Laminator is a versatile 40" laminator capable of freestanding lamination, encapsulation and mounting of digital inkjet output using thermal films or pressure sensitive (PSA) films. This is an excellent entry-level production unit to complement wide format inkjet printers. (thermal or PSA)

When an image leaves the computer, it could end up anywhere. Digital output today can mean many things. You need a system that can finish all of today

The Catenas are uniquely designed, versatile color finishing systems which allow you to create an endless variety of graphic applications from your digital color output. Each machine in the Catena series is designed to work hand-in-hand with digital color output, delivering an affordable and accessible option in laminating, encapsulating and mounting exciting presentation graphics on demand.

While the applications of the Catena can be quite sophisticated, the operation can be done simply and safely, even in the smallest office. The magnetically latched safety shield allows for easy removal and replacing when changing film and the user friendly control panel allows the operator to adjust heat and speeds for different thicknesses of paper, films and mounting substrates.

GBC is the name known throughout the printing and on-demand industry for quality laminating and finishing films. The Catena machines are designed to take advantage of thermal films and pressure-sensitive films such as GBC's Octiva, Octiva Lo-Melt and Arctic over-laminates and mounting adhesives as well as a variety of textured vinyl films and mounting boards.

The Catena's thermal films range from 1 mil to 10 mil thick. Hi-Tac films are specially engineered to adhere to toners with high fuser oil content. The Catena 65 and 105 machines will also accommodate wax-based and heat-sensitive materials, utilizing our pressure-sensitive cold-laminating film.

GBC has been leading technological advances in lamination for more than 30 years, so you know your investment will be supported with unbeatable service, the world's largest inventory of in-stock thermal films and innovative features like GBC's infrared heated roller design which distributes heat evenly and quickly across the heat rollers for perfect, scratch-free lamination. So advanced, infrared heat sensors instantly sense heat variation on the rollers and control the heat on/off process and the silicone rubber heat rollers reduce adhesive buildup and cleaning time and provide for a clean, scratch-less edge seal.

The Catenas can mount images to a variety of materials. Adjustable roller pressure adjusts easily to accommodate mounting materials up to 3/16 of an inch thick. GBC has designed the Catena to meet your specific finishing needs. Images up to 12 inches wide can be finished on the Catena 35. The Catena 65 can finish output up to 25 inches wide and for wide-format images, the Catena 105 can mount and laminate images up to 40 inches wide. From small point of purchase displays to wide images, the Catenas can mount and finish it all.

Staff Review

GBC Catena 105 Roll Laminator Review

Roll laminators offer the perfect solution for when you need to laminate very large documents. One roll laminator you should consider is the GBC Catena 105. Here are its strengths and weaknesses.

Strengths:

  • The Catena 105 is the perfect laminator to use when working with wide-format documents. It can laminate items that are up to 40 inches wide, so it's perfect for posters, signage, and other large displays.
  • This machine is compatible with film that's up to 10 mil thick. Ten mil film is the thickest available and it's perfect for items that will be handled a lot or exposed to the elements. You can use both thermal and pressure-sensitive film with this device. (When using pressure-sensitive film, the rewind roller will peel away the backing so you don't have to.)
  • The Catena 105 is compatible with rolls of laminating film that have cores either 1” or 2.25”: thick. There's a special adapter you can use if your film has  3” core.
  • This device operates at speeds ranging from 1.5 to 5 feet per minute. Whatever the size of document you're laminating, it'll will definitely be processed quickly.
  • This device has adjustable speed and temperature settings so you'll be able to get the right results for no matter which document you're laminating. The temperature and speed settings are all shown on an LCD display. (The display will also let you know when the device is ready for use.)
  • The Catena 105 has silicone rollers so you can be sure you're getting the smoothest results possible. There's also a cooling fan that ensures things will look great and that the machine as whole won't overheat.
  • If you want to use mounting board to prepare visual aids or displays, you can so with the Catena 105. There are roller gap adjustment handles that you can manipulate so the machine will be able to accommodate boards that are up to 3/16” thick.

Weaknesses:

  • This laminator takes a long time to warm up. It will probably take about 10 minutes before it's ready for use.
  • It almost goes without saying that roll laminators tend to be large and the Catena 105 is no exception. It has dimensions of 51" (width) x 48" (height) x 21" (depth) and it weighs just over 150 pounds, so you'll need to exercise caution when moving it.
  • Unfortunately, this device has a shorter warranty than the majority of GBC's products. It only comes with 90 days of coverage.

The GBC Catena 105 is definitely a good choice if you're looking for a roll laminator. It has a lot of great features, such as its compatibility with both thermal and pressure-sensitive films. You'll be able to laminate all kinds and sizes of documents with this device, and you'll also find it easy to do. You'll just need to give the device ample time to warm up as well as be careful when moving it. If you do, you'll find that the Catena 105 may be the perfect roll laminator for you.
